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in Kennewick generally starts around $15,000 for a basic update with standard materials and can easily range from $25,000 to $50,000+ for high-end fixtures, custom tile work, or complex layout changes. Tub-to-shower conversions are a highly popular service, with costs typically ranging from $5,000 to $12,000 depending on the complexity and materials chosen.

In Kennewick,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the scope and material choices. Key cost factors include the size of your bathroom, the extent of plumbing/electrical work, and your selections for cabinetry, countertops, and fixtures. Local material and labor costs, which are generally moderate for the region, along with any necessary updates to meet current Washington State building codes, will also impact the final price.
Kennewick's semi-arid climate, with hot summers and cold winters, makes material selection and proper ventilation critical. We recommend materials resistant to expansion and contraction from temperature swings, like porcelain tile. A high-quality, properly sized exhaust fan vented directly outside is non-negotiable to combat humidity from showers and prevent mold, which can be a concern despite our dry climate if moisture is trapped indoors.
Yes, permits from the City of Kennewick Community Development Department are typically required for structural changes, plumbing, and electrical work. Local regulations align with the Washington State Building Code, which includes specific requirements for bathroom ventilation, GFCI outlet placement, and water-efficient fixtures. A reputable local contractor will handle this process, ensuring your remodel is safe, compliant, and passes final inspection.
While interior remodels can be done year-round, late winter and early spring (January-April) are often ideal for scheduling in Kennewick. This period typically avoids the peak construction season of summer, potentially offering better contractor availability. It also allows the project to be completed before the intense summer heat, which can be a consideration if your home's cooling is disrupted or if you need to ventilate dust frequently.
Always verify that a contractor is licensed, bonded, and insured in Washington State. Ask for local references and view portfolios of completed projects in the Tri-Cities area to assess their experience with homes similar to yours. A trustworthy Kennewick contractor will provide a detailed, written estimate, clearly outline the project timeline, and communicate openly about how they will manage dust, debris, and daily workflow in your home.
